Battery, alternator, or starter??
If this is in the wrong forum, please feel free to relocate it to the proper section. I apologize in advance if it is.
Went out to start my 98 SE (formerly my Dad'*) this morning, opened the car door, all the interior lights bright as usual, turned the key, all the lights went out and no crank. Dead as a doornail. Checked cables and cleaned them, looked for any loose wires anywhere else. Opened the door to get back in, interior lights on again and bright, and as soon as i turn the key, everything goes dead.
Battery and starter have both been replaced within the last twelve months. Any ideas???
